The murder of Charlie Kirk, a prominent conservative activist, has sent shockwaves through the political landscape. Tyler Robinson, the individual accused of this heinous crime, has been linked to disturbing actions leading up to the event. Reports indicate that Robinson dined at a Chick-fil-A and changed clothes shortly before the alleged shooting, sparking concerns about premeditation.
In recent court sessions, evidence has emerged suggesting Robinson's prior interactions with Kirk's group, further complicating the narrative.
